GAMEPLAY OVERVIEW
Core Combat Flow
City Brawl centers on close-range street combat using punches, kicks, grabs, and defensive blocks. Players face waves of hostile residents ranging from common fighters to stronger boss enemies. Every encounter demands careful spacing, quick reactions, and proper attack timing to survive longer fights. Enemy behavior increases pressure by attacking from multiple angles across busy environments. Boss encounters introduce tougher patterns requiring patience and controlled movement. Victories unlock progression while defeats encourage learning enemy behavior and positioning.
Progression and Fighter Growth
The game features a steady power curve shaped through rewards earned from battles and achievements. Fighters gain upgrades after successful street encounters and completed challenges. Each upgrade changes combat effectiveness through improved power, speed, or defensive capability. Character variety influences combat rhythm and encourages experimenting with different upgrade paths. Reputation increases gradually as players clear districts and defeat stronger opponents. New districts appear with heavier resistance, creating a consistent sense of advancement.
District Design and Challenge Scaling
Urban districts present packed sidewalks, tight alleys, and increasingly aggressive enemy groups. Environmental density increases difficulty by limiting movement and escape options. Later districts apply stronger resistance and faster enemies to test learned combat skills. Daily content introduces fresh challenges and stronger rivals for returning players. District progression supports replayability without requiring long continuous sessions. Each run delivers new combat situations while maintaining familiar control mechanics.
CONTROLS GUIDE
- Q: Punch
- W: Kick
- E: Grab the opponent’s head
- Space: Jump
- Left / Right Arrow Keys: Move left or right
